Cecil B. DeMille 1881
- 1865 - Disinfectant was used for the first time during surgery by Joseph Lister.
- 1877 - Thomas Edison invented the phonograph and made the first sound recording.
- 1898 - The Spanish-American War was ended with the signing of the peace protocol. The U.S. acquired Guam, Puerto Rico and the Philippines. Hawaii was also annexed.
- 1981 - IBM unveiled its first PC.
- 1992 - The U.S., Canada, and Mexico announced that the North American Free Trade Agreement had been created after 14 months of negotiations.

Duke University School of Law, seventh-best nationally in a U.S. News & World Report ranking and consistent member of the national T14 list, discriminated based on race in admissions for the 2023, 2024 and 2025 classes, says the Civil Rights Division of the U.S. Department of Justice.
Federal officials said the university's conduct violated Title VI of the Civil Rights Act of 1964 and the U.S. Supreme Court's 2023 decision in Students for Fair Admissions v. Harvard. The former prohibits discrimination on basis of race, color or national origin; the latter banned race discrimination in higher education.
